Match #6 (26 Jan 08): 4-1 win over Messilon

as the song by boney m goes....by the sidelines of st wilfrid.....on arriving today at the ground, we saw the babylonians and some thought 'oh, them again!' st wilfrid, their spiritual homeground? there was half of them when the match started and the main team were actually from messier services. nevertheless, it was one we had to win.

in the hot 3pm sun, things started slowly and we managed to string the first 10 passes together, a good sign. babylon had lefty and a older guy upfront, so we didn't had much trouble as we know what to do. mandarin-speaking malay boy was pulling the strings in the middle, but we make sure there's defensive cover. we pressed well in their third and were 1 up after such an endeavor. we forced a corner and fr wah's delivery, their defender sliced the ball for st to complete the simple task of flicking a header beyond keeper's reach. messilon got a little demoralised and we dominated a bit. off a good springy attack, we stretch them and wah played a superb ball fr the left to the middle. fr way out, mark thumped a first timer on the top of his boots. the trajectory of the shot was like an unerring arrow fr robin hood, right on the mark!

unfortunately our achilles heel was to be exposed again. with 5 defenders marking players against their corner, lefty was allowed to power a free header to reduce the deficit. then it was our turn to profit fr a corner. messilon didn't clear properly and chye smashed home the loose ball in the melee.

half-time was welcomed relief but messylon became messier as the babylonians left. we were hoping to knock in a couple of goals and then reshuffle the positions as part of our new training scheme (to appreciate the roles played by team-mates). unfortunately, we seemed to suffer fr the old problem of playing poorly against weaker oppositions. chances went begging. it was not until late on when wah had some space on the left to knock in a cross which sailed delightfully passed the stranded keeper and found the inside netting. 4-1 final score.

2 weeks ago, after a dreadful start to the season, we called for a committed response. 8 goals scored and 3 conceded, ah...a good rebound. just like the stock market!
